Prerequisite: SOWK 227 Reviews and analyzes theory and knowledge from the behavioral and social environment sequence of courses to discover specific implications for social work practice. Areas of focus include social system, community, groups, family and the individual. Covers the age span from middle-adulthood to old age. Spring semester.
